Why You Need a Travel Yoga Mat

Benefits of a Travel Yoga Mat

A travel yoga mat offers numerous benefits for yogis on the go. Portability is one of the key advantages, allowing you to practice yoga anywhere, whether you're in a hotel room, at the beach, or in a park. These mats are designed to be lightweight and compact, making them easy to carry in your luggage or backpack. Additionally, travel yoga mats often come with features like quick-drying surfaces and antimicrobial properties, ensuring that your practice remains hygienic even when you're away from home.

Comparing Travel Mats to Regular Mats

When comparing travel mats to regular mats, the primary differences lie in their weight and thickness. Travel mats are generally thinner and lighter, which makes them easier to transport but may offer less cushioning. Regular mats, on the other hand, provide more support and are better suited for a permanent practice space. Here's a quick comparison:

Feature Travel Yoga Mat Regular Yoga Mat
Weight Light Heavy
Thickness Thin Thick
Portability High Low
Cushioning Less More

Key Features to Look for in a Travel Yoga Mat

Portability and Weight

When choosing a travel yoga mat, portability is crucial. A lightweight mat is easier to carry around, especially if you're frequently on the move. Look for mats that can be easily folded or rolled up to fit into your luggage without taking up too much space.

Material and Durability

The material of the mat significantly impacts its durability and performance. Natural rubber, PVC, and TPE are common materials, each with its own benefits. Natural rubber is eco-friendly and offers excellent grip, while PVC is durable and easy to clean. TPE is a newer, eco-friendly option that combines the best of both worlds.

Grip and Comfort

A good travel yoga mat should provide a balance between grip and comfort. The surface should be sticky enough to prevent slipping, even during intense sessions. Additionally, the mat should offer enough cushioning to protect your joints without being too bulky.

Top Materials for Travel Yoga Mats

When selecting a travel yoga mat, the material is a crucial factor to consider. Different materials offer varying benefits and drawbacks, so it's essential to choose one that aligns with your needs and preferences.

Natural Rubber

Natural rubber mats are known for their excellent grip and durability. They provide a stable surface for practice, even in sweaty conditions. However, they can be heavier and less portable compared to other options.

PVC

PVC mats are lightweight and often more affordable. They are easy to clean and maintain, making them a popular choice for many yogis. On the downside, PVC is not the most eco-friendly material, which might be a concern for environmentally conscious practitioners.

TPE and Other Eco-Friendly Options

TPE (Thermoplastic Elastomer) mats are a great alternative for those looking for an eco-friendly option. They are lightweight, durable, and provide good grip and comfort. Many eco-conscious yogis prefer TPE mats because they are free from harmful chemicals and are recyclable.

How to Maintain and Clean Your Travel Yoga Mat

Cleaning Techniques

Regular cleaning of your travel yoga mat is essential to maintain hygiene and extend its lifespan. Use a gentle, non-abrasive cleaner to avoid damaging the mat's surface. A mixture of water and mild soap works well for most mats. For a deeper clean, consider using a specialized yoga mat cleaner.

Steps to clean your mat:

  1. Lay the mat flat on a clean surface.
  2. Spray the cleaning solution evenly across the mat.
  3. Wipe down with a soft cloth.
  4. Allow the mat to air dry completely before rolling it up.

Storage Tips

Proper storage of your travel yoga mat can prevent wear and tear. Always roll your mat with the top side facing out to avoid curling edges. Store it in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to prevent material degradation. If possible, use a carrying bag to protect it from dust and dirt.

When to Replace Your Mat

Even with the best care, travel yoga mats will eventually need replacing. Signs that it's time for a new mat include:

  • Noticeable wear and tear
  • Loss of grip
  • Persistent odors despite cleaning

Travel Yoga Mat Accessories You Might Need

When you're on the move, having the right accessories can make your yoga practice more convenient and enjoyable. Here are some essential travel yoga mat accessories to consider:

Carrying Bags

A carrying bag is essential for transporting your travel yoga mat. Look for a bag that is lightweight and has adjustable straps for easy carrying. Some bags even come with extra pockets for storing small items like keys or a phone.

Cleaning Sprays

Keeping your mat clean is crucial, especially when practicing in different environments. A good cleaning spray can help maintain hygiene and extend the life of your mat. Opt for a natural, eco-friendly spray to avoid harsh chemicals.

Mat Towels

A mat towel can be a lifesaver, especially if you tend to sweat a lot during your practice. These towels are designed to absorb moisture and provide extra grip, making your practice safer and more comfortable.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between a travel yoga mat and a regular yoga mat?

Travel yoga mats are typically lighter and more compact than regular yoga mats, making them easier to carry around. They are designed for portability without compromising on grip and comfort.

How do I clean my travel yoga mat?

You can clean your travel yoga mat by wiping it down with a mixture of water and mild soap. For a deeper clean, you can use a yoga mat cleaner spray. Always allow it to air dry completely before rolling it up.

Can I use a travel yoga mat for daily practice?

Yes, you can use a travel yoga mat for daily practice, but keep in mind that they are generally thinner and may provide less cushioning than regular mats. If you need more support, consider using it on a carpeted surface or with an additional mat.

What is the best material for a travel yoga mat?

The best material for a travel yoga mat depends on your needs. Natural rubber offers excellent grip and eco-friendliness, PVC is durable and affordable, while TPE is lightweight and also eco-friendly.

How do I store my travel yoga mat when not in use?

Store your travel yoga mat in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. You can roll it up and keep it in a carrying bag to protect it from dust and damage.

When should I replace my travel yoga mat?

You should replace your travel yoga mat when it shows signs of wear and tear, such as thinning, loss of grip, or visible damage. Regularly inspect your mat to ensure it provides adequate support and safety.
